技术员 发表于 2024-8-23 06:45:22

传奇版本服务端使用技能神石锻造学习技能的功能脚本(GOM引擎)

传奇版本服务端使用技能神石锻造学习技能的功能脚本(GOM引擎)[@main]
#IF
equal U47 0
#act
mov U31 5
mov U32 5
mov U33 5
mov U34 5
mov U35 5
mov U47 888

#IF
CHECKSKILL 刺PK剑术 = 0 1
#ACT
mov U31 5
#IF
CHECKSKILL 刺PK剑术 = 1 1
#ACT
mov U31 6
#IF
CHECKSKILL 刺PK剑术 = 2 1
#ACT
mov U31 7
#IF
CHECKSKILL 刺PK剑术 = 3 1
#ACT
mov U31 8
#IF
CHECKSKILL 刺PK剑术 = 4 1
#ACT
mov U31 9
#IF
CHECKSKILL 刺PK剑术 = 5 1
#ACT
mov U31 10
#IF
CHECKSKILL 刺PK剑术 = 6 1
#ACT
mov U31 11
#IF
CHECKSKILL 刺PK剑术 = 7 1
#ACT
mov U31 12
#IF
CHECKSKILL 刺PK剑术 = 8 1
#ACT
mov U31 13
#IF
CHECKSKILL 刺PK剑术 = 9 1
#ACT
mov U31 14

#IF
CHECKSKILL 开天斩 = 0 1
#ACT
mov U32 5
#IF
CHECKSKILL 开天斩 = 1 1
#ACT
mov U32 6
#IF
CHECKSKILL 开天斩 = 2 1
#ACT
mov U32 7
#IF
CHECKSKILL 开天斩 = 3 1
#ACT
mov U32 8
#IF
CHECKSKILL 开天斩 = 4 1
#ACT
mov U32 9
#IF
CHECKSKILL 开天斩 = 5 1
#ACT
mov U32 10
#IF
CHECKSKILL 开天斩 = 6 1
#ACT
mov U32 11
#IF
CHECKSKILL 开天斩 = 7 1
#ACT
mov U32 12
#IF
CHECKSKILL 开天斩 = 8 1
#ACT
mov U32 13
#IF
CHECKSKILL 开天斩 = 9 1
#ACT
mov U32 14

#IF
CHECKSKILL 逐日剑法 = 0 1
#ACT
mov U33 5
#IF
CHECKSKILL 逐日剑法 = 1 1
#ACT
mov U33 6
#IF
CHECKSKILL 逐日剑法 = 2 1
#ACT
mov U33 7
#IF
CHECKSKILL 逐日剑法 = 3 1
#ACT
mov U33 8
#IF
CHECKSKILL 逐日剑法 = 4 1
#ACT
mov U33 9
#IF
CHECKSKILL 逐日剑法 = 5 1
#ACT
mov U33 10
#IF
CHECKSKILL 逐日剑法 = 6 1
#ACT
mov U33 11
#IF
CHECKSKILL 逐日剑法 = 7 1
#ACT
mov U33 12
#IF
CHECKSKILL 逐日剑法 = 8 1
#ACT
mov U33 13
#IF
CHECKSKILL 逐日剑法 = 9 1
#ACT
mov U33 14


#IF
CHECKSKILL 烈火剑法 = 0
#ACT
mov U34 5
#IF
CHECKSKILL 烈火剑法 = 1
#ACT
mov U34 6
#IF
CHECKSKILL 烈火剑法 = 2
#ACT
mov U34 7
#IF
CHECKSKILL 烈火剑法 = 3
#ACT
mov U34 3
#IF
CHECKSKILL 烈火剑法 = 4
#ACT
mov U34 4




#IF
CHECKSKILL 魔法盾 = 0
#ACT
mov U35 5
goto @778877
break

#IF
CHECKSKILL 魔法盾 = 1
#ACT
mov U35 6
goto @778877
break


#IF
CHECKSKILL 魔法盾 = 2
#ACT
mov U35 7
goto @778877
break


#IF
CHECKSKILL 魔法盾 = 3
#ACT
mov U35 3
goto @778877
break


#IF
CHECKSKILL 魔法盾 = 4
#ACT
mov U35 4
goto @778877
break

#IF

#ACT
mov U35 5
goto @778877
break


[@778877]
#IF
#ACT
OPENMERCHANTBIGDLG 20 0 1 4 -30 -40 1 375 51
#SAY
<><PlayImg:0:1197:21:100:125:5:0:0>\
<>\
<>\ \ \
<>                     <Img:<$STR(U31)>:20:2:30> <Img:1:20:2:0/@强化1>\
<>                     <Img:<$STR(U32)>:20:2:80> <Img:1:20:2:50/@强化2>\
<>                     <Img:<$STR(U33)>:20:2:131> <Img:1:20:2:101/@强化3>\
<>                     <Img:<$STR(U34)>:20:2:182> <Img:1:20:2:152/@强化4>\
<>                     <Img:<$STR(U35)>:20:2:233> <Img:1:20:2:203/@强化5>\
<><Img:492:1:50:260>

[@强化1]
#if
CHECKSKILL 刺PK剑术 = 9 1
#act
messagebox 您已完成9重刺PK剑术的**,无法再次**
break

#if
CHECKSKILL 刺PK剑术 < 9 1
checkitem技能神石 10
#act
take       技能神石 10
SKILLLEVEL 刺PK剑术 + 1 1
GuildNoticeMsg 251 135 技能通告:玩家:[<$USERNAME>]将其「刺PK剑术」境界提升了一重
goto @main
#ELSEACT
messagebox \ \   对不起,条件不足,无法强化技能
BREAK

[@强化2]
#if
CHECKSKILL 开天斩 = 9 1
#act
messagebox 您已完成9重开天斩的**,无法再次**
break

#if
CHECKSKILL 开天斩 < 9 1
checkitem技能神石 10
#act
take       技能神石 10
SKILLLEVEL 开天斩 + 1 1
GuildNoticeMsg 251 135 技能通告:玩家:[<$USERNAME>]将其「开天斩」境界提升了一重
goto @main
#ELSEACT
messagebox \ \   对不起,条件不足,无法强化技能
BREAK

[@强化3]
#if
CHECKSKILL 逐日剑法 = 9 1
#act
messagebox 您已完成9重逐日剑法的**,无法再次**
break

#if
CHECKSKILL 逐日剑法 < 9 1
checkitem技能神石 10
#act
take       技能神石 10
SKILLLEVEL 逐日剑法 + 1 1
GuildNoticeMsg 251 135 技能通告:玩家:[<$USERNAME>]将其「逐日剑法」境界提升了一重
goto @main
#ELSEACT
messagebox \ \   对不起,条件不足,无法强化技能
BREAK

[@强化4]
#if
CHECKSKILL 烈火剑法 = 4
#act
messagebox 您已完成4级烈火剑法的**,无法再次**
break

#if
CHECKSKILL 烈火剑法 = 3
checkitem技能神石 100
#act
take       技能神石 100
SkillLevel 烈火剑法 = 4
SendCenterMsg5 255 恭喜玩家:『<$USERNAME>』成功强化了技能:四级烈火,他在战斗中伤害更加爆炸 1 15
messagebox 四级烈火强化成功
goto @main
#elseact
messagebox \ \   对不起,条件不足,无法强化技能
break


[@强化5]
#if
CHECKSKILL 魔法盾 = 4
#act
messagebox 您已完成4级魔法盾的**,无法再次**
break

#if
CHECKSKILL 魔法盾 = 3
checkitem技能神石 600
#act
take       技能神石 600
ADDSKILL   魔法盾   3
SkillLevel 魔法盾 = 4
SendCenterMsg5 255 恭喜玩家:『<$USERNAME>』成功强化了技能:四级魔法盾,他在战斗中生存能力得以加强 1 15
messagebox 四级魔法盾强化成功
goto @main
#elseact
messagebox \ \   对不起,条件不足,无法强化技能
break

页: [1]
查看完整版本: 传奇版本服务端使用技能神石锻造学习技能的功能脚本(GOM引擎)